Red Fort Blast Accused Dr. Umar Nabi’s House Demolished in Pulwama

Srinagar: Authorities have demolished the residential house of Dr. Umar Nabi, the prime accused in the recent Red Fort blast, in Koil area of south Kashmir’s Pulwama district.

News agency GNS quoted official sources as saying that the demolition was carried out during the intervening night using a controlled explosion. The action, they said, was part of the ongoing investigation and security measures following the deadly blast.

Dr. Umar Nabi, identified as the main conspirator, was reportedly seen driving a white i20 vehicle at the Red Fort moments before it exploded, resulting in the death of at least 13 people.

The blast drew sharp condemnation from the Union Government.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s cabinet, during a high-level security meeting, denounced the incident as a cowardly act perpetrated by anti-national elements.
